HR 5422 · 108th Congress · Government Operations and Politics

To support the Boy Scouts of America and the Girl Scouts of the United States of America.

Introduced 2004-11-24· Sponsored by Rep. Davis, Jo Ann [R-VA-1]· House

Latest: Referred to the House Committee on Government Reform.(2004-11-24)

[AI summary unavailable — showing source text] Prohibits any Federal law, rule, or regulation from being construed to limit any Federal agency from providing any form of support to the Boy Scouts of America or the Girl Scouts of the United States of America, including: (1) holding meetings, jamborees, camporees, or other scouting activities on Federal property if such organization has received permission from the appropriate Federal official responsible for such property; or (2) hosting or sponsoring any official event of such organization.…
